A MAP sensor that is a constant 18-20 kPa is usually a sign that it is connected backwards. We used to see this a lot in the old V2.2 (and V1.01) boards people built themselves, because it was easy to get them the 'wrong side up' on the board. See #12 here: http://www.megamanual.com/v22manual/mwire.htm#trouble
So you might want to check your wiring.
